The current visit of Tempus HESDeSPI project Higher Educational System Development for Social Partnership Improvement and Humanity Sciences Competitiveness took place in 2011, October 15-16-17, at YSAFA and YSUAC by Hans Skoglund.
The latter came from Sweden as an external expert from European Union part for investigating and evaluating the current process of above-mentioned institutions. Within the frames of this visit presentations were held both at YSAFA and YSUAC, they also met the representatives of advisory board, they visited the museum of modern art. Gafeschyan foundation, International curators’ association, they met the head of modern fine arts Sona Harutyunyan from the Ministry of Culture of Armenia, the coordinator of Tempus National office in Armenia Lana Karlova, they discussed the role of cooperation with the social partners in the field of art.
Evaluation of the “Tempus HESDESPI” project
Tempus programme project HESDESPI
Performed by Hans Skoglund
Stockholm, Sweden 2011-11-05
During my short time (October 15-16, 2011) visit to Armenia I focused on the project events planned by the work plan. It was assessed overall presence situation within the program on the basis of the negotiations and discussions with staff and students of the Yerevan State University of Architecture and Construction (YSUAC).
The Yerevan State Academy of Fine Arts and Yerevan State University of Architecture and Construction staff participated in the meeting with their presentations. Many issues were clarified through the discussion and Q&A.
Program aspects evaluated:
Quality of the study programmes concept in related study courses (Humanity sciences, Culture administration); presence of elaborated 5 study modules and representation of necessary topics and skills in them.
a) Presence of training materials for elaborated study courses (quality and languages available) .
b) Methodological recommendations for developing qualification exam/paper content.
c) Process of approbation and testing of training modules.
d) Links between the current study programme and other courses of study in the study related organisational unit.
e) The compliance of study programmes with needs of labour market and future skills of graduates, the co-operation with labour market is justified (concluded contracts, agreements, meeting protocols etc.).
f) The compliance of study programmes structure and content with legal regulations in partner country.
g) Quality of implementation of study programmes- availability of human and technical resources.
h) Use of state-of-the art equipment for implementing of educational programmes (e.g. computers, multimedia techniques, software).
i) Existence of developed professional standard for each qualification.
j) Conformity of professional qualification for involvement in European Qualification Framework, development of documentation regarding ECTS and EQF
k) Level of development of methodological recommendations regarding improvement of higher education offer, content and educational and management processes
l) Publications in mass media and informative articles regarding the project and its outcomes
